Create a tenant.
Tenants are logical containers that group related SES resources together. Each tenant can have its own set of resources like email identities, configuration sets, and templates, along with reputation metrics and sending status. This helps isolate and manage email sending for different customers or business units within your Amazon SES API v2 account.
This is an asynchronous operation using the standard naming convention for .NET 4.5 or higher. For .NET 3.5 the operation is implemented as a pair of methods using the standard naming convention of BeginCreateTenant and EndCreateTenant.

public abstract Task<CreateTenantResponse> CreateTenantAsync( CreateTenantRequest request, CancellationToken cancellationToken )
Container for the necessary parameters to execute the CreateTenant service method.
A cancellation token that can be used by other objects or threads to receive notice of cancellation.
Exception | Condition |
---|---|
AlreadyExistsException | The resource specified in your request already exists. |
BadRequestException | The input you provided is invalid. |
LimitExceededException | There are too many instances of the specified resource type. |
TooManyRequestsException | Too many requests have been made to the operation. |
